Williams could tinker against Gills

Williams blasted the O's, who were unbeaten in 2010 before kick-off at the weekend, following the clash and believes that the players may have become too comfortable.He said: "The first half performance was way below the standards we've set ourselves this year and we deservedly came in losing. We put on a much better second half, but we've come away with nothing and it's very disappointing."Sean Thornton and Scott McGleish were replaced in the 53rd minute of the clash against Les Parry's men by James Scowcroft and Jonathan Tehoue and both will be vying for a starting berth following the loss.Winger Jimmy Smith earned a recall to Williams' side at the weekend after Nicky Adams was recalled to Leicester last week and he should retain his place in the starting XI.Williams has no fresh injury or suspension worries to contend with as he tries to get his side's play-off ambitions back on track.
